Original Description
Immerse yourself in the dappled sunlight of Sous-bois (Underbrush), one of Paul Cézanne’s evocative woodland studies from the late 1880s to 1890s. This masterpiece captures the Provençal forest with vigorous brushstrokes, where fractured planes of green, ochre, and blue weave a dense tapestry of foliage. Unlike traditional landscapes, Cézanne’s "constructed" approach—pioneering Cubism—transforms nature into interlocking geometric forms, pulsating with energy. The painting exudes both tranquility and dynamism, as if the forest breathes between structured chaos and harmony. Created during his experimental period in Aix-en-Provence, Sous-bois reflects Cézanne’s pursuit of "solidifying Impressionism," bridging 19th-century spontaneity and 20th-century abstraction. Today, it stands as a testament to his influence on modern art, admired for its radical reimagining of spatial depth and natural forms.
